#7f1b49 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7f1b49 is composed of 49.8% red, 10.6% green and 28.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 78.7% magenta, 42.5%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 332.4 degrees, a saturation of 64.9% and a lightness of 30.2%. #7f1b49 color hex could be obtained by blending #fe3692 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

Shades and Tints of #7f1b49

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0308 is the darkest color, while #fefd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#7f1b49

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#504a4d is the less saturated color, while #970347 is the most saturated one.
